In this paper, reduced graphene oxide- cobalt ferrite (rGO-CoFe2O4) nanocomposites were successfully synthesized by using the hydrothermal method. The phase formation of CoFe2O4 nanoparticles was confirmed by using X-ray diffraction (XRD) study. The study of surface morphology of rGO-CoFe2O4 nanocomposites was performed by using scanning electron microscopy (SEM) technique and EDAX image are used for elemental analysis. Magnetic property measurement and determination of various magnetic parameters of rGO-CoFe2O4 nanocomposites was carried out by physical property measurement system (PPMS). These results indicate that the rGO-CoFe2O4 used as a soft magnetic material by changing the temperature value.
